...fy;">An advanced form of hydroponics, aeroponics farming is the procedure of plant cultivation in a mist environment by spraying micro droplets of nutrient solution on the roots of plant in a closed habitat in order to procure fast and healthy plant growth. It is a soil-less culture as soil is just the medium for the plant for nutrients ingestion. As nutrients are supplied in an air water culture in the form of mist directly to the roots.
